673508
0x74d6c50f8d99f623fa9283739a52970b2cdc9392032e833eb858831804c96a82
Transactions0
Height673508
Confirmations15963117
Timestamp1338 days 9 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0xb0659a5f63bcae1c
Bits
Difficulty0x344bfc5